The Citiblog

Inside the Museum of Illusions
September 30, 2018, 10:19.57 pm ET

Print

Museum of Illusions, Chelsea, NYC

Museum of Illusions, Chelsea, NYC

Museum of Illusions, Chelsea, NYC

Museum of Illusions, Chelsea, NYC

Museum of Illusions, Chelsea, NYC
Photos: Kenroy Lumsden

Comments:
^Top